Jase Ess as Lord Evelyn Oakleigh in Anything Goes

Jase Ess appeared on stage at the Art Theatre in the CC Production of Anything Goes by Cole Porter.


Playing the character of Lord Evelyn Oakleigh, Jase sang and danced away with Emily Sharp in their onstage duet 'Let's Misbehave', which received positive reviews including 'perfectly cast', 'played his role very convincingly' and a 'professional finish to his performance'.


Choreography by Annie Fox

Musical Direction by Peter Schmidt

Directed by Jeff Sawade

Arts Theatre, Adelaide SA - 1993


Picture: Jase Ess as 'Lord Evelyn Oakleigh' and Emily Sharp as 'Reno' in their dance number 'Let's Misbehave'.
